"The first part of this biography of Paul Landres is organized as a sort of prose documentary, with Landres's reminiscences interspersed with Nevins's own narration. The second part contains four accounts of Landres's moviemaking experiences in the 1950s and '6Os, in the words of the man who lived them. A filmography of Paul Landres's work and sixteen pages of photos complete this study of a man who has been, in the author's own words, "an unknown treasure" - at least until now."--BOOK JACKET.
